The Kyoto City Board of Education distributed an alcohol disinfectant solution manufactured by a company that handles cosmetics in Gion * to schools in order to help prevent infection with the new coronavirus.

The alcohol disinfectant was manufactured by a long-established company that handles cosmetics and hairpins in Gion since the Edo period at the request of the city's board of education.



The disinfectant solution is distributed to 125 elementary and junior high schools in the city. Of these, at Kaisei elementary and junior high schools in Higashiyama-ku, Kyoto, children can use their hands and fingers when going to and from school, before lunch, and after classes outside such as physical education.
